WeightLoss🍏 361 to 229 lbs !
Hope everyone’s doing well !
There’s approximately 18 months between the 2 pics, but i didn’t exactly spend the entirety of that period in a caloric deficit. I would occasionally consume my daily maintenance specially after i started hitting the gym which was towards the second half of that period. However, for the majority of the that time i was in a 600-800 daily caloric deficit.

Need Advice ⁉️ 30 second rest vs 3 min rest ? Confused asf
If two men perform the same exercise with strict form, train close to or to failure, and use progressive overload by increasing reps rather than weight, which approach would produce more hypertrophy and why?
- Person A does 3 sets with 3 minutes of rest between sets.
- Person B does 5 sets with only 30 seconds of rest between sets.
- Because of the shorter rest, Person B gets fewer reps per set, but all reps are still performed with good form and high effort.
Would the extra sets with shorter rest produce similar, more, or less muscle growth than fewer sets with longer rest? And if fatigue increases motor-unit recruitment, could the shorter-rest approach compensate for the lower reps per set?
